HARDSUB chapters: image-only, transcript_unavailable.","citation_preferred":true,"untrusted_fields_separated":true},"trusted":{"series":{"title":"Solo Leveling","slug":"solo-leveling-3f7061","original_title":"나 혼자만 레벨업"},"chapter":{"number":120,"chapter_key":"120","release_date":"2025-03-02","last_updated":"2026-07-30T15:29:58.075Z","summary":"Having abandoned his own raid to race to his sister's side, Sung Jinwoo makes a dramatic entrance at the high school just as Sung Jin-Ah is captured by the orc boss. The chapter resolves the previous cliffhanger with immense reader satisfaction, as Jinwoo's timely arrival is met with overwhelming relief and excitement. The comments reveal a fanbase that was holding its breath, deeply invested in Jin-Ah's safety. This moment crystallizes Jinwoo's core motivation, shifting his focus from abstract power growth to the immediate, brutal protection of his family. Readers overwhelmingly praise his protective nature, hailing him as the \"best brother\" and admiring his cold, menacing fury. His intimidating presence is highlighted by a fan-favorite moment where he contemptuously cuts off the orc leader's self-introduction, signaling the massacre to come. The collective sentiment is one of bloodthirsty anticipation, with readers eagerly awaiting the merciless slaughter of the monsters who made the fatal mistake of threatening his family. This event is seen as a peak moment for the series, showcasing the terrifying resolve of the Shadow Monarch when his loved ones are on the line.","summary_source":"graph_aggregator","summary_status":"generated","summary_verification":"unverified"},"summary":"Having abandoned his own raid to race to his sister's side, Sung Jinwoo makes a dramatic entrance at the high school just as Sung Jin-Ah is captured by the orc boss.
